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Cochin

    You'll arrive at Cochin airport and head to your hotel to settle in. Once you're ready, the afternoon opens up to explore the main sights around the city. The Dutch Palace shows off Kerala's colonial architecture, and from there you can walk through Jew Town with its narrow lanes and antique shops. The Jewish Synagogue sits in this same area, followed by the spice market where the scent of cardamom, pepper, and cinnamon fills the air. St. Francis Church is also on the route. By evening, you'll catch a traditional Kathakali dance performance, a classical art form native to Kerala.

  2. Day 2

    Cochin to Munnar

    After breakfast you'll drive about 4 hours north to Munnar, a hill station sitting at high elevation in the Western Ghats. Once you check in, the rest of the day is yours to relax and take in the views around the property. If you're interested, tea plantations are nearby for a visit, or you could try paragliding if you want something more active. It's mainly a travel day with time to adjust to the cooler mountain climate.

  3. Day 3

    Munnar

    Today is a full day of sightseeing around Munnar. You'll see Anamudi, the tallest peak in South India, which offers panoramic views across the region. Christ Church is worth a stop for its architecture and history. Head to Eravikulam National Park to look for wildlife like Nilgiri tahr and other mountain species. Then move on to Rajamalai Hills, followed by Madupetty Dam where you can go boating or try horse riding. Top Station wraps up the day with more high-altitude views and cooler mountain air.

  4. Day 4

    Munnar to Periyar

    After eating, you'll spend 4 hours driving to Periyar and check into your hotel. In the evening, there's an option to take a boat ride on Periyar Lake where tigers, elephants, wild boar, and deer come to drink. The lake itself sits within a wildlife sanctuary, so sightings aren't guaranteed but the setting is worth it. If wildlife watching doesn't appeal, nearby tribal villages offer visits where you can learn how local communities traditionally collect honey and live off the land.

  5. Day 5

    Periyar to Kumarakom

    A 3 hour drive brings you to Kumarakom, where you'll check in at a backwater resort built right along the water. The rest of your day is free to spend however you like. Most people take a walk along the backwaters or book a small boat ride to see the local fishing techniques and village life. The backwaters are a series of interconnected lagoons and lakes, creating a serene landscape with coconut palms lining the shores.

  6. Day 6

    Kumarakom to Alleppey

    After breakfast you'll head to Kottayam to board your houseboat. This is an overnight journey south along the backwaters toward Alleppey, so you'll spend the evening and night on the water. The houseboat has all the comforts you need, and meals are typically served on board. As you travel, you'll pass through narrow canals, village areas, and open water, giving you a real sense of how Kerala's backwaters function as both transportation and livelihood for local people.

  7. Day 7

    Alleppey to Kovalam

    You'll disembark from the houseboat in Alleppey and then transfer south to Kovalam, a beach town. Check in at your beachfront hotel and the day is yours to use as you wish. The beach here has golden sand and relatively calm water, so swimming is easy. You can lounge, sunbathe, play beach volleyball, or just walk along the shore. An optional Ayurvedic massage treatment can be arranged at the hotel if you want to relax that way instead.

  9. Day 9

    Kovalam to Trivandrum

    You'll drive to Trivandrum for a city tour focusing on Padmanabhaswamy Temple, a major pilgrimage site for Hindu Vaishnavites. The temple has intricate carvings across 400 pillars and is considered one of the 108 most important temples in the faith. The architecture and artwork alone make it worth the visit. After the temple tour, the afternoon is free, giving you time to head back to the beach or explore other parts of the city at your own pace.
